Australia is a popular destination for exchange students from all over the world. It is a country that offers a rich mix of stunning landscapes, vibrant culture and a high quality of life, making it an attractive destination for tourists, students and those wishing to reside in the country. There are numerous options available for those wishing to experience Australia: for young students, summer camps and high school programs, and for adults, programs ranging from a language course with work permit to a university degree.

Australia is an island country with continental dimensions, located in the southern hemisphere, between the Indian Ocean and the Pacific Ocean. It is the sixth largest country in the world in terms of total area.

 

Australian culture is a rich blend of indigenous Aboriginal traditions and British influences, along with contributions from immigrants from around the world. In addition to English, which is the country's official language, there are also many indigenous languages, reflecting the cultural diversity of the Aboriginal people.

 

The country is known for its laid-back lifestyle and love of sports such as cricket and Australian rules football.

The Australian economy is diversified and one of the most developed in the world. Major sectors include mining, agriculture, financial services, tourism and education. Australia is also a major exporter of wine.
